Home is Where Your Story Begins

Love this old photo of my Dad’s Childhood home!
For dimension, I cut the beautiful diamonds and glued directly over the same diamonds on the paper using pop dots. I then cut the same images from the Cold Country 6×6 paper and glued that down.

I mixed some black India ink with molding paste and used the gorgeous Nature Walk Stencil in random places on my layout.

I gave the gorgeous chippies a coat of black paint and lightly brushed on some watered down gesso.


I put the new stamp collections from Nature Walk and Cold Country to good use as they make for an awesome background!


I stamped the butterflies from the Nature Walk Stamps onto a sheet of acetate using Staz on Ink. I lightly colored with purple alcohol ink and then cut out.
